Recommended Tire Storage Covers For ST205/75R15 Tires On Tandem Utility Trailer  

Question:

Hi, I live in Montana and recently purchased a dual axle utility trailer. I am looking for covers to protect the tires in the winter snow. A dual tire cover configuration would be preferable. Thank you.

Expert Reply:

I can certainly help you out with that. The ST205/75R15 tires you have should measure right at 27" in diameter so in this case the most affordable route would be Adco Tyre Gard RV Wheel Covers - Designer Series - 27" to 29" - Tan # 290-3963. This is a kit that comes with all four covers that you would need for your dual axle trailer; the covers are heavy duty and water-repellant so they will do a great job of protecting against all the elements.

Since you mentioned a dual tire cover, you could go with Adco Tyre Gard RV Wheel Cover - Double Axle - 27" to 29" - Vinyl - Diamond Plate # 290-3723 (this is for one side, so you will need a quantity of two). These covers are also heavy duty and weather-resistant but they do require a bungee cord or rope to keep them tight, such as SmartStraps Bungee Cord w/ Coated Steel Hooks - Adjustable - 28" to 48" - Yellow # 348509.

I personally would go with the kit that includes four single covers, # 290-3963, since they have integrated Velcro straps and do not need bungee cords or rope to secure tightly to the tires. I also think they look better. A couple demonstration videos have been linked to further assist you.
